The Jammu police have arrested two drug peddlers and seized seven grams of heroin under the ongoing operation ‘Sanjeevani’. The arrests were made by a police team from Bishnah, which had set up a temporary check-point during routine patrolling.

Advertisement

While frisking the suspects, the police recovered heroin from two individuals, identified as Showkat Ali and Khadim Hussain, both residents of Sikandar Pur in Bishnah. Following the recovery, the duo was arrested on the spot.

Advertisement

A police spokesperson confirmed, “The accused were immediately taken into custody, and a case was registered under the relevant sections of the NDPS Act at the Bishnah police station.”
